Hanoi, May 10 -- The Association of Southeast Asian Nations (ASEAN) has reaffirmed its shared ambition to accelerate the region's transition towards carbon neutrality and sustainable growth by 2030, according to the ASEAN Chair's statement released on May 9. The statement said that the bloc welcomes the progress in the implementation of the ASEAN Regional Investment Action Plan 2025-2030, which seeks to attract foreign investment in green transition and post-pandemic priority recovery sectors. These include carbon capture and storage, biofuels, medical devices, solar photovoltaic equipment, veterinary health care, and green and sustainable building materials.
